На главную Наши проекты:
Журнал   ·   Discuz!ML   ·   Wiki   ·   DRKB   ·   Помощь проекту
ПРАВИЛА FAQ Помощь Участники Календарь Избранное RSS
msm.ru
Страницы: (3) [1] 2 3  все  ( Перейти к последнему сообщению )  
    > Управление светодоидами , ПК, диоды, делфи.
      Привет всем! Подскажите, перед мной стоит задача - нужно написать программу, которая будет включать диоды, непосредственно с ПК, конкретней, что мне нужно? как я понимаю какой то приборчик, который будет подсоединятся к ПК(какой именно, через какой порт), а с другой стороны будут припаяны диоды! остается программа(Делфи)? Мужики а проще, если кто то знает или понимает о чем я, напишите подробно, от и до?
      p.s как бы глупо это не звучало, но если кто то реально поможет, заплачу)
      Сообщение отредактировано: shustr1k76 -
        Для начала нужен тот самый приборчик. Программа управления – это вторично.
          а какой нужен, мне б самый простой, какое подключение usb или lpt, что лучше и проще?
            Цитата shustr1k76 @
            а какой нужен

            не знаю. мне всё равно.
              Цитата shustr1k76 @
              а какой нужен, мне б самый простой, какое подключение usb или lpt, что лучше и проще?
              Надо какую-то ардуину с RS232 поглядеть. :scratch:

              Добавлено
              Загляните на нашем форуме в раздел Hardware-Аппаратные средства. Там явно быстрее наткнётесь на полезный совет. :yes:
                Цитата shustr1k76 @
                какое подключение usb или lpt, что лучше и проще?

                Если есть в наличии LPT, светодиоды можно воткнуть и без специальных девайсов в количестве 12 шт. Гуголь даже знает как.
                Сообщение отредактировано: x128 -
                  Цитата shustr1k76 @
                  ...понимаю какой то приборчик, который будет подсоединятся к ПК(какой именно, через какой порт)...

                  HID устройство на базе программатора микроконтроллеров AVR можно убрать от туда резисторы R7, R8 и вообще не ставить резисторы R10-R14 и все что после них.

                  Исходные коды берем здесь: AVR-USB
                  Как работать с HID с Windows

                  Ну на крайний случй я что то там паял, прошу не относиться особо критично к моим постам: моя поделка.

                  Ну чем прошивать AVR найдете с помощью гугла. Ну или здесь http://myrobot.ru/wiki/index.php?n=Projects.MyPROGGER кстати его (программатор) тоже можно использовать для мигания светодиодов, подключаемся через COM
                    Цитата
                    Мужики а проще, если кто то знает
                    бу клавира, нет ничего проще. Можно управлять ее светодиодами, выковыривайте платку ее контроллера. Причем можно управлять индикаторами без нажатия кнопок и раздельно индикаторами разных клавир :) http://raxp.radioliga.com/cnt/s.php?p=kbd.zip. Если нагрузок немного, то и USB/UART конвертор подойдет (программирвать нижний уровень не нужно), а если много, то и на сдвиговом регистре можно http://raxp.radioliga.com/cnt/s.php?p=comcdex.zip (нижний уровень тоже программировать не нужно)
                    http://www.youtube.com/watch?v=zj7LvleuZlk.

                    А если что-то более многофункциональное, то уже конечно Ардуины, Расперри, Куби-боарды или хардкор - самому паять, вытравливать, прошивать :)

                    А вообще начните с прочтения Если сломалась клавиша Fn... или управляем устройствами в один клик и данных тем: 1
                    2
                    3
                    4
                    Сообщение отредактировано: raxp -
                      http://mavius.mavjuz.com/projects/lpt/ то что нужно, подскажите можно ли запилить программу на делфи, а не брать что там предлогают?
                        Цитата shustr1k76 @
                        то что нужно, подскажите можно ли запилить программу на делфи, а не брать что там предлогают?

                        Можно. А вы что компьютер с LPT нашли?
                          Цитата Pavia @
                          Можно. А вы что компьютер с LPT нашли?

                          да :crazy:
                            И у меня их аж три (компа)! :D
                            Комп с LPT - дефицит теперь.
                              http://lexwebmaster.narod.ru/lpt_delphi.html подскажите, это ведь то что нужно, или нужна доработка кода?
                                shustr1k76
                                Цитата shustr1k76 @
                                подскажите, это ведь то что нужно, или нужна доработка кода?

                                Должно работать проверяйте экспериментально.
                                Нет пределу совершенства.

                                Воспользуйтесь первой ссылкой http://mavius.mavjuz.com/projects/lpt/
                                Там в принципе всё описано.
                                В зависимости от ОС надо использовать соответствующей драйвер.
                                В зависимости от драйвера потребуется соответствующая DLL и заголовочные файлы к DLL.
                                Нудна проверка на загрузку и установку драйвера. Как минимум нет проверки на наличие "inpout32.dll".
                                Нет выбора базового порта: 378h, 278h, 3BCh, другой(для PCI).
                                Нет проверки или настройки режим работы порта
                                ISA-Compatible Mode
                                PS/2-Compatible Mode
                                EPP Mode
                                ECP
                                  Цитата Pavia @
                                  В зависимости от ОС надо использовать соответствующей драйвер.
                                  В зависимости от драйвера потребуется соответствующая DLL и заголовочные файлы к DLL.
                                  Нудна проверка на загрузку и установку драйвера. Как минимум нет проверки на наличие "inpout32.dll".
                                  Нет выбора базового порта: 378h, 278h, 3BCh, другой(для PCI).
                                  Нет проверки или настройки режим работы порта
                                  ISA-Compatible Mode
                                  PS/2-Compatible Mode
                                  EPP Mode
                                  ECP


                                  ОС - XP
                                  "inpout32.dll" - имеется
                                  порт настроить вроде не сложно(в EPP)

                                  а это не много не понял:
                                  Нет выбора базового порта: 378h, 278h, 3BCh, другой(для PCI).- на сколько может отличаться от старенького ПК?
                                  В зависимости от драйвера потребуется соответствующая DLL и заголовочные файлы к DLL.- самому писать нужно будет?

                                  чтоб самому себе помочь, и облегчит вашу помощь))) от меня какая то информация нужна?
                                  Сообщение отредактировано: shustr1k76 -
                                  0 пользователей читают эту тему (0 гостей и 0 скрытых пользователей)
                                  0 пользователей:
                                  Страницы: (3) [1] 2 3  все


                                  Рейтинг@Mail.ru
                                  [ Script execution time: 0,0467 ]   [ 16 queries used ]   [ Generated: 19.03.24, 09:12 GMT ]